Staff Python Engineer @

2 weeks ago


Warszawa, Mazovia, Czech Republic Box Inc. Full time
Candidate Profile
  • Essential Skills: 
  • Strong proficiency in Python, including debugging and profiling. 
  • Broad software engineering expertise across multiple languages and paradigms. 
  • Experience with distributed systems, Kubernetes, and cloud environments. 
  • Ability to debug complex system-level issues (threading, networking, VM behavior). 
  • Strong architectural thinking, ensuring consistency across services. 
  • Valuable Skills: 
  • Node.js and JavaScript experience, especially with adapters and integrations. 
  • Exposure to frontend development patterns (not required but helpful). 
  • Familiarity with enterprise migrations or large-scale content management. 
  • Mindset: 
  • Systems thinker who can see both deep technical detail and cross-service architectural alignment. 
  • Opinionated yet collaborative, able to challenge peers respectfully. 
  • Proactive ownership and drive to ensure solutions are complete and correct. 
  • Diplomatic leadership style that mentors and uplifts senior engineers while maintaining technical authority. 

Shuttle is Box's enterprise migration solution. Its mission is to help organizations securely and efficiently move their content from legacy systems and third-party storage providers into Box. This is critical for customer adoption, as smooth migration is often the first step to unlocking value from Box's platform. Shuttle ensures migrations are reliable, scalable, and maintain fidelity of files, metadata, and permissions. 

,[Own architectural consistency and validate significant technical decisions across Shuttle's services., Design and guide the evolution of critical systems, including the migration adapters and backend microservices., Drive resolution of complex system-level problems, whether in Kubernetes orchestration, cloud VMs, or network behavior., Ensure fixes address root causes, not just symptoms., Provide technical mentorship and oversight to senior and mid-level engineers., Collaborate with other Box teams on integrations (Box Consulting, Archive, Metadata initiatives and most likely File System and API in the future)., Contribute to roadmap planning by aligning Shuttle's architecture with Box's broader goals, especially around metadata and AI. ] Requirements: Python, Node.js, JavaScript, Kubernetes, Terraform, GCP Tools: Jira, Confluence, GitHub, GIT, Agile, Scrum. Additionally: Creative tax, Stock options, Life & group insurance, Private healthcare, Udemy for business, Phone reimbursement, Sport/fitness reimbursement, International projects, Flat structure, Friendly atmosphere, Additional holidays, Inclusive culture, Developental events, No probation period, Equity, ESSP.

  • Warszawa, Mazovia, Czech Republic VISA Full time

    Basic Qualifications:5+ years of relevant work experience with a Bachelor's Degree or at least 2 years of work experience with an Advanced degree (e.g. Masters, MBA, JD, MD) or 0 years of work experience with a PhD, OR 8+ years of relevant work experience.Preferred Qualifications:6 or more years of work experience with a Bachelors Degree or 4 or more years...


  • Warszawa, Mazovia, Czech Republic beBeeSoftware Full time 540,000 - 720,000

    Job Title: AI Software Engineer - Machine LearningWe are seeking a seasoned AI software engineer to join our team. As a key member of our technical staff, you will be responsible for designing and developing innovative machine learning models that drive business growth.Key Responsibilities:Design and develop cutting-edge machine learning models using...


  • Warszawa, Mazovia, Czech Republic Asana Full time

    About youYou're a strong and experienced software engineer who's comfortable writing and reading code – this isn't an ops role.You care about reliability, scalability, and long-term maintainability, not just quick fixes.You might have worked as an SRE before – or maybe you were a product engineer who kept getting pulled into infra work because you...


  • Warszawa, Mazovia, Czech Republic Spyrosoft Full time

    Requirements:Practical experience with Quantum or similar treasury management systems. Strong background in software development with the ability to work across multiple programming languages. Hands-on experience with cloud platforms and CI/CD processes (Jenkins, Terraform). Familiarity with agile practices such as TDD, pair programming, mob programming,...


  • Warszawa, Mazovia, Czech Republic beBeePython Full time €90,000 - €110,000

    Senior Python Engineer OpportunityWe are seeking an experienced Senior Python Engineer to contribute to the development of our internal tools at Klarna.You will design, build, and maintain microservices using Python, focusing on seamless integration with internal APIs and third-party systems.You will monitor system performance and user experience using...


  • Warszawa, Mazovia, Czech Republic beBeeSystem Full time 1,275,000 - 2,025,000

    Drive System Evolution as a Staff EngineerWe're seeking an experienced Staff Engineer to propel the growth of our critical systems, including migration adapters and backend microservices. Your expertise will ensure architectural consistency, validate technical decisions, and resolve complex system-level problems. Additionally, you'll provide technical...


  • Warszawa, Mazovia, Czech Republic Link Group Full time

    At least 6 years of professional software development experience, ideally with exposure to distributed, high-performance systems (experience in financial services is a plus).Strong expertise in server-side Python, including object-oriented programming, algorithms, data structures, concurrency, and performance optimization.Practical knowledge of NumPy and...


  • Warszawa, Mazovia, Czech Republic Spyrosoft Full time

    Strong proficiency in Python, with hands-on experience building RESTful APIs using FastAPI, Flask, or Django.Solid understanding of the AWS cloud platform, including services like Lambda and ECS, and a working knowledge of microservices architecture.Passion for AI technologies, with exposure to large language models (LLMs), natural language processing...


  • Warszawa, Mazovia, Czech Republic Link Group Full time

    4+ years of professional experience as a backend developer using Python.Bachelor's degree in Computer Science, Engineering, or a related field.Experience with AWSProven experience designing and implementing backend systems from architecture to production.Strong skills in code optimization, performance tuning, and relational database design (MSSQL...


  • Warszawa, Mazovia, Czech Republic Spyrosoft Full time

    Proven commercial experience as a Senior Developer in Python – essential for backend development, scripting, and automation tasksMastery of Python language features, data structures (lists, dictionaries), web frameworks (Django, Flask, FastAPI), and testing (pytest)Experience with AWS EC2, Terraform, CloudFormation, and KubernetesFamiliarity with...